[4-[3-amino-6-(dimethylamino)acridin-9-yl]phenyl]-dimethylazanium chloride

Also Known As: Rheonine, Basic Orange 23, 3-Amino-6-dimethylamino-9-dimethylaminophenylacridine hydrochloride, ACRIDINE, 3-AMINO-6-(DIMETHYLAMINO)-9-(p-DIMETHYLAMINOPHENYL)-, HYDROCHLORIDE, [4-[3-amino-6-(dimethylamino)acridin-9-yl]phenyl]-dimethylazanium chloride

CAS: 6441-75-4
Molecular Formula C23H25ClN4
Molecular Weight 392.18 g/mol
LogP 0.48
Topological Polar Surface Area 46.6 Ų
Hydrogen Bond Donors 2
Hydrogen Bond Acceptors 4
Rotatable Bonds 3
Exact Mass 392.1768
Heavy Atoms 28
Complexity 485.0

Chemical Identifiers

CAS Number 6441-75-4
SMILES C[NH+](C)C1=CC=C(C=C1)C2=C3C=CC(=CC3=NC4=C2C=CC(=C4)N)N(C)C.[Cl-]
InChIKey BIBYJGHMQQFXPN-UHFFFAOYSA-N
